1. Premiere Dates
Premiere dates significantly impact the success of television programs, and March 2025 releases will be no exception. Strategic scheduling considers various factors, including competition from other networks, major events like sports championships or awards ceremonies, and even seasonal viewing habits. A premiere date in early March might capitalize on audiences seeking indoor entertainment during colder weather, while a late March release could target viewers anticipating spring break programming. For instance, a network might choose to debut a highly anticipated drama series in early March to build momentum before the premiere of a rival network’s returning hit show later in the month.
The selection of a March premiere date can also influence marketing and publicity campaigns. Networks often build anticipation through targeted advertising, social media engagement, and early screenings. The timing of these campaigns is crucial for maximizing audience awareness and generating pre-release buzz. A well-chosen March premiere date allows networks to leverage these strategies effectively, potentially reaching a wider audience. Historically, successful March premieres have established strong viewership foundations, contributing to a program’s long-term performance.

3. Network Competition
Network competition significantly influences programming strategies surrounding television series slated for March 2025 release. Each network aims to capture the largest possible audience share, leading to strategic scheduling decisions designed to maximize viewership. This competition manifests in various ways, including direct scheduling conflicts, counter-programming strategies, and targeted marketing campaigns. For example, two networks might simultaneously premiere highly anticipated dramas on the same night, creating a direct competition for viewers. Alternatively, a network might schedule a lighter, comedic program against a competitor’s serious drama, aiming to attract viewers seeking different content. Understanding network competition provides crucial context for interpreting programming choices and anticipating audience reception.
The impact of network competition extends beyond premiere dates. Ongoing competition influences marketing and publicity efforts, as networks strive to differentiate their offerings and attract viewers. This competition can lead to innovative marketing campaigns, increased social media engagement, and strategic partnerships with other media outlets. The intensity of network competition often escalates during premiere months like March, as networks aim to establish strong viewership early in the season. This heightened competition can result in more aggressive marketing strategies, increased media coverage, and even greater emphasis on pre-release buzz generation. 4. Targeted Demographics
Targeted demographics play a crucial role in shaping the development, scheduling, and marketing of television series, including those planned for March 2025. Networks analyze viewership data, market research, and industry trends to identify key demographic groups for specific programs. This analysis influences content creation, scheduling choices, and advertising strategies. For instance, a network targeting a younger demographic might develop a teen drama with social media integration and schedule it during prime viewing hours for that audience. Conversely, a program aimed at an older demographic might focus on more mature themes and be scheduled during the early evening or daytime hours. The alignment between targeted demographics and program content maximizes audience engagement and potential viewership.
Understanding targeted demographics allows networks to tailor content to specific audience preferences. This includes considerations of genre, themes, casting choices, and even pacing. A program targeting families might emphasize heartwarming storylines and feature a diverse cast, while a series targeting a niche audience might explore more complex narratives and employ a more stylized aesthetic. This targeted approach increases the likelihood of attracting and retaining viewers within the desired demographic, contributing to a program’s overall success. Furthermore, understanding targeted demographics enables networks to make informed decisions regarding advertising and promotional strategies. Networks can strategically place advertisements for a particular series on channels or platforms frequented by the targeted demographic, maximizing reach and impact.

5. Anticipated Viewership
Anticipated viewership represents a critical factor influencing programming decisions, marketing strategies, and overall network performance for television series slated for March 2025 release. Projections of viewership inform resource allocation, advertising pricing, and scheduling strategies. Accurate forecasting enables networks to optimize programming choices and maximize return on investment.
-
Pre-Release Buzz
Pre-release buzz, generated through marketing campaigns, social media engagement, and critical previews, significantly impacts anticipated viewership. A strong pre-release buzz can translate into higher initial viewership figures, setting the stage for a successful run. For example, a series generating significant online discussion and positive early reviews might experience higher viewership during its premiere week. In the context of March 2025 releases, generating substantial pre-release buzz is crucial for capturing audience attention amidst a crowded media landscape.
-
Returning Series vs. New Programs
Established series often benefit from pre-existing fan bases, contributing to more predictable viewership patterns. New programs, however, face the challenge of capturing audience attention and building a viewership base from scratch. Networks often rely on extensive marketing and strategic scheduling to maximize viewership potential for new series. In March 2025, returning series with established audiences might offer a more stable viewership projection compared to new, unproven programs.
-
Competitive Programming
The competitive landscape of television programming significantly influences anticipated viewership. Premiering a new series against an established hit on a competing network can negatively impact viewership. Conversely, strategic counter-programming, offering alternative genres or targeting different demographics, can potentially attract a larger audience share. For March 2025 releases, analyzing competitive programming choices will be essential for accurate viewership projections.
-
Platform and Distribution
The increasing prevalence of streaming platforms and on-demand viewing options complicates viewership projections. While traditional television ratings remain relevant, networks must also consider viewership across multiple platforms, including streaming services and online platforms. Accurately assessing viewership across various platforms becomes crucial for evaluating the overall success of March 2025 releases. This necessitates more sophisticated data analysis and consideration of evolving viewing habits.
